Because he can't accompany his father, a German army officer, on his next deployment in Somalia, 15-year-old Tim has to move in with his grandmother on the North Sea island of Amrum. There, the cool skater from Berlin, who seems to magically attract problems, immediately loses his reputation as a freak and difficult outsider. Only chubby Eric, who suffers teasing and attacks from the surfer clique around rich Lars, stands by him. When Tim also falls in love with pretty Vic, Lars' girlfriend, a fight is inevitable.
